Varsity Gold K-8/ Sales - Fundraising for Schools
at Varsity Gold K-8 in Palm Springs, CA
Varsity Gold K-8 seeks energetic, persuasive, entrepreneurial sales professionals to help elementary & middle schools raise money while developing new territories and expanding our current client base. Our Sales Representatives have the opportunity to build relationships and grow a business which directly impacts the community. Responsibilities include cold-calling and selling to principals, PTA presidents, other school advisors and merchants in the surrounding area of Riverside, California, including Banning, Moreno Valley, and Palm Springs.
The candidate should currently live in or relocate to the sales territory. Relocation costs are not covered.
Salary is a monthly draw against commission. This opportunity is a full-time independent contractor position. Other salary details will be explained upon interview. Ongoing company training is provided.
Varsity Gold K-8 is the elementary & middle school division of Varsity Gold, Inc., a marketing and fundraising services company with sales representatives in the United States and Canada. Varsity Gold works with more than 12,500 high school programs and is considered the largest athletic fundraising group in the country, raising almost $40 million for local school programs and other non-profit organizations. Requirements
The ideal candidate has 1-2 years of outside sales experience, a college degree and a proven ability to work independently in building his or her own client portfolio. Strong relationship building skills, public speaking skills and entrepreneurial drive are essential. A successful candidate is a self-disciplined, hard worker with the desire to build his or her own business.
